Microservices & Event Schema Modeling
Design robust asynchronous message contracts, CloudEvents payloads, and synchronous inter-service communication standards.
Engagement Specifications
Distributed architectures frequently collapse due to brittle, undocumented message schemas. We design formal event contracts using AsyncAPI, CloudEvents, and Protocol Buffers to maintain strict domain segregation, reliable event sourcing, and consumer-driven contract testing.

Architecture Phases
Execution Process
01. Event Storming & Schema Definition
Map system state transitions to immutable domain event specifications.
02. Evolution & Compatibility Rules
Set forward/backward schema compatibility modes and schema registry enforcement rules.
03. Integration Testing Blueprints
Deliver automated verification harness for producer and consumer validation.
